John Roskill was the nominee of the Hamilton Liberal Association who were not prepared to accept John Ramsay as their candidate. Prior to polling day Roskill agreed to arbitration by the Scottish Liberal Association and when they found that Ramsay had the most support in the constituency Roskill then withdrew. Galloway Weir did not agree to take part in the arbitration and continued his campaign. | |||
